快速轉型低代碼平臺:企業(yè)數(shù)字化轉型的加速器
在當今數(shù)字化時代,企業(yè)面臨著前所未有的轉型壓力。低代碼平臺作為一種新興的技術解決方案,為企業(yè)提供了快速構建和部署應用程序的能力,從而加速數(shù)字化轉型。本文將探討如何快速將系統(tǒng)轉變?yōu)榈痛a平臺,助力企業(yè)轉型提速。
一、構建標準化組件庫:降低開發(fā)門檻
定義:標準化組件庫是指將企業(yè)中常用的功能模塊、界面元素等進行封裝,形成可復用的組件庫,以降低開發(fā)門檻,提高開發(fā)效率。
核心目的:通過構建標準化組件庫,企業(yè)可以減少重復開發(fā)工作,縮短項目周期,降低人力成本。

實施流程: 1. 分析企業(yè)現(xiàn)有應用,識別常用功能模塊和界面元素。 2. 設計組件庫架構,包括組件分類、命名規(guī)范等。 3. 開發(fā)和封裝組件,確保組件具有良好的可復用性和可維護性。 4. 建立組件庫管理機制,包括組件版本控制、更新維護等。
方法: 1. 采用模塊化設計,將功能模塊拆分為獨立的組件。 2. 使用可視化工具進行組件開發(fā),提高開發(fā)效率。 3. 建立組件評審機制,確保組件質量。 4. 定期更新組件庫,適應業(yè)務需求變化。
問題及解決策略: 1. 組件庫更新不及時:建立自動化更新機制,確保組件庫與業(yè)務需求同步。 2. 組件質量參差不齊:建立組件評審機制,確保組件質量。 3. 組件復用性差:優(yōu)化組件設計,提高組件的通用性和可復用性。
二、引入可視化開發(fā)工具:提升開發(fā)效率
定義:可視化開發(fā)工具是一種通過圖形化界面進行應用程序開發(fā)的工具,用戶可以通過拖拽組件、配置屬性等方式快速構建應用程序。
核心目的:可視化開發(fā)工具可以降低開發(fā)門檻,提高開發(fā)效率,縮短項目周期。
實施流程: 1. 選擇合適的可視化開發(fā)工具,考慮其功能、易用性、兼容性等因素。 2. 對開發(fā)人員進行可視化開發(fā)工具的培訓,確保其熟練使用。 3. 引導開發(fā)人員使用可視化開發(fā)工具進行項目開發(fā)。 4. 對可視化開發(fā)工具進行持續(xù)優(yōu)化,提高其易用性和性能。
方法: 1. 選擇功能強大的可視化開發(fā)工具,支持多種編程語言和框架。 2. 提供豐富的組件庫,滿足不同業(yè)務需求。 3. 優(yōu)化用戶界面,提高易用性。 4. 提供良好的技術支持,解決開發(fā)過程中遇到的問題。
問題及解決策略: 1. 開發(fā)效率低:優(yōu)化工具性能,提高開發(fā)速度。 2. 代碼質量差:建立代碼規(guī)范,確保代碼質量。 3. 工具兼容性差:選擇兼容性好的工具,降低兼容性問題。
三、建立敏捷開發(fā)流程:快速響應市場變化
定義:敏捷開發(fā)是一種以人為核心、迭代、循序漸進的開發(fā)方法,強調快速響應市場變化,持續(xù)交付高質量軟件。
核心目的:通過建立敏捷開發(fā)流程,企業(yè)可以快速響應市場變化,提高產品競爭力。
實施流程: 1. 建立敏捷開發(fā)團隊,明確團隊成員職責。 2. 制定敏捷開發(fā)計劃,包括迭代周期、里程碑等。 3. 實施敏捷開發(fā),持續(xù)交付高質量軟件。 4. 對敏捷開發(fā)流程進行持續(xù)優(yōu)化,提高開發(fā)效率。
方法: 1. 采用Scrum、Kanban等敏捷開發(fā)方法。 2. 建立快速反饋機制,及時調整開發(fā)計劃。 3. 定義:數(shù)據(jù)集成與API管理是指通過集成不同的數(shù)據(jù)源和應用系統(tǒng),以及管理API接口,實現(xiàn)數(shù)據(jù)的高效流通和共享,打破數(shù)據(jù)孤島。四、強化數(shù)據(jù)集成與API管理:打破數(shù)據(jù)孤島
核心目的:強化數(shù)據(jù)集成與API管理,可以確保企業(yè)內部數(shù)據(jù)的一致性和可用性,提高業(yè)務流程的自動化水平。
實施流程: 1. 評估現(xiàn)有數(shù)據(jù)源和應用系統(tǒng),確定集成需求。 2. 選擇合適的數(shù)據(jù)集成工具和API管理平臺。 3. 設計數(shù)據(jù)集成方案,包括數(shù)據(jù)映射、轉換和同步。 4. 開發(fā)和部署數(shù)據(jù)集成和API管理解決方案。 5. 建立監(jiān)控和優(yōu)化機制,確保數(shù)據(jù)集成和API管理的穩(wěn)定性和效率。
方法: 1. 采用ETL(提取、轉換、加載)工具進行數(shù)據(jù)集成。 2. 使用API網(wǎng)關進行API管理,提供統(tǒng)一的接口訪問入口。 3. 實施RESTful API設計,確保接口的易用性和可擴展性。 4. 定期審查和更新API文檔,確保開發(fā)人員能夠快速理解和使用API。
問題及解決策略: 1. 數(shù)據(jù)同步延遲:優(yōu)化數(shù)據(jù)同步策略,減少延遲。 2. API性能瓶頸:優(yōu)化API性能,提高響應速度。 3. 數(shù)據(jù)安全問題:實施嚴格的數(shù)據(jù)訪問控制和加密措施。
五、培養(yǎng)數(shù)字化人才:構建企業(yè)核心競爭力
定義:數(shù)字化人才是指具備數(shù)字化技能和知識,能夠推動企業(yè)數(shù)字化轉型的人才。
核心目的:培養(yǎng)數(shù)字化人才,可以幫助企業(yè)更好地理解和應用低代碼平臺,構建企業(yè)的核心競爭力。
實施流程: 1. 評估企業(yè)現(xiàn)有人才隊伍的數(shù)字化能力。 2. 制定數(shù)字化人才培養(yǎng)計劃,包括培訓課程、實踐項目等。 3. 與外部培訓機構或高校合作,提供專業(yè)培訓。 4. 建立數(shù)字化人才激勵機制,鼓勵員工持續(xù)學習和成長。 5. 定期評估人才培養(yǎng)效果,調整培訓計劃。
方法: 1. 開展內部培訓,如工作坊、研討會等。 2. 鼓勵員工參加外部認證,提升個人技能。 3. 實施導師制度,讓經驗豐富的員工指導新員工。 4. 建立數(shù)字化人才庫,記錄員工的學習和成長軌跡。
問題及解決策略: 1. 培訓效果不佳:優(yōu)化培訓內容和方法,確保培訓的實用性和針對性。 2. 員工積極性不高:建立有效的激勵機制,提高員工參與度。 3. 人才流失:提供有競爭力的薪酬和職業(yè)發(fā)展機會,留住人才。
六、實施持續(xù)集成與持續(xù)部署:加速應用迭代
定義:持續(xù)集成與持續(xù)部署(CI/CD)是一種自動化軟件交付流程,通過自動化構建、測試和部署,加速應用迭代。
核心目的:實施CI/CD,可以縮短應用迭代周期,提高軟件質量,降低部署風險。
實施流程: 1. 建立自動化構建和測試環(huán)境。 2. 設計持續(xù)集成和持續(xù)部署流程。 3. 部署自動化工具,如Jenkins、GitLab CI等。 4. 對CI/CD流程進行監(jiān)控和優(yōu)化。 5. 建立反饋機制,及時調整CI/CD策略。
方法: 1. 采用容器化技術,如Docker,簡化部署過程。 2. 實施自動化測試,包括單元測試、集成測試等。 3. 使用自動化部署工具,如Kubernetes,實現(xiàn)快速部署。 <
七、擁抱云計算:構建彈性架構
定義:云計算是一種基于互聯(lián)網(wǎng)的計算模式,通過互聯(lián)網(wǎng)提供動態(tài)易擴展且經常是虛擬化的資源。
核心目的:擁抱云計算可以幫助企業(yè)構建彈性架構,實現(xiàn)資源的按需分配和快速擴展,降低IT成本。
實施流程: 1. 評估企業(yè)現(xiàn)有IT基礎設施,確定云計算需求。 2. 選擇合適的云服務提供商,如阿里云、騰訊云等。 3. 設計云計算架構,包括云服務類型、部署模式等。 4. 部署云計算資源,包括虛擬機、數(shù)據(jù)庫、存儲等。 5. 監(jiān)控和優(yōu)化云計算資源,確保其穩(wěn)定性和效率。
方法: 1. 采用IaaS、PaaS、SaaS等云服務類型,滿足不同業(yè)務需求。 2. 使用容器化技術,如Docker,實現(xiàn)應用程序的輕量級部署。 3. 實施自動化運維,提高運維效率。 4. 建立云安全策略,確保數(shù)據(jù)安全和合規(guī)性。
問題及解決策略: 1. 云計算成本高:合理規(guī)劃云計算資源,避免浪費。 2. 云服務不穩(wěn)定:選擇可靠的云服務提供商,確保服務穩(wěn)定性。 3. 數(shù)據(jù)遷移困難:采用漸進式遷移策略,降低遷移風險。
八、引入人工智能與機器學習:賦能業(yè)務創(chuàng)新
定義:人工智能與機器學習是計算機科學的一個分支,它使計算機能夠模擬人類智能行為,如學習、推理、感知等。
核心目的:引入人工智能與機器學習可以幫助企業(yè)實現(xiàn)業(yè)務創(chuàng)新,提高運營效率,增強客戶體驗。
實施流程: 1. 識別企業(yè)業(yè)務場景,確定人工智能與機器學習應用需求。 2. 選擇合適的人工智能與機器學習工具和平臺。 3. 開發(fā)和部署人工智能與機器學習應用。 4. 監(jiān)控和優(yōu)化人工智能與機器學習應用,確保其穩(wěn)定性和效率。
方法: 1. 采用深度學習、自然語言處理等技術,實現(xiàn)智能識別、預測和分析。 2. 使用大數(shù)據(jù)技術,處理和分析海量數(shù)據(jù)。 3. 建立人工智能與機器學習團隊,負責應用開發(fā)和維護。 4. 與外部專家合作,獲取技術支持和解決方案。
問題及解決策略: 1. 技術門檻高:提供培訓和支持,幫助員工掌握相關技能。 2. 數(shù)據(jù)質量差:建立數(shù)據(jù)治理機制,確保數(shù)據(jù)質量。 3. 應用效果不佳:持續(xù)優(yōu)化應用,提高應用效果。
九、打造開放生態(tài)系統(tǒng):促進合作共贏
定義:開放生態(tài)系統(tǒng)是指企業(yè)通過與其他企業(yè)、開發(fā)者、用戶等合作,共同構建和分享價值,實現(xiàn)合作共贏。
核心目的:打造開放生態(tài)系統(tǒng)可以幫助企業(yè)拓展市場,吸引更多合作伙伴,提高企業(yè)競爭力。
實施流程: 1. 評估企業(yè)現(xiàn)有合作伙伴和生態(tài)系統(tǒng),確定合作需求。 2. 制定開放生態(tài)系統(tǒng)戰(zhàn)略,包括合作伙伴選擇、合作模式等。 3. 建立合作伙伴關系,包括技術合作、市場合作等。 4. 監(jiān)控和優(yōu)化合作伙伴關系,確保合作共贏。
方法: 1. 提供開放API接口,方便合作伙伴接入和應用。 2. 建立開發(fā)者社區(qū),鼓勵開發(fā)者創(chuàng)新和應用開發(fā)。 3. 與行業(yè)組織合作,共同推動行業(yè)發(fā)展。 4. 定期舉辦合作伙伴大會,加強溝通與合作。
問題及解決策略: 1. 合作伙伴關系不穩(wěn)定:建立長期穩(wěn)定的合作關系,確保合作共贏。 2. 在當今數(shù)字化轉型的浪潮中,企業(yè)都在尋求一種高效、便捷的方式來加速其數(shù)字化轉型進程。將系統(tǒng)轉變?yōu)榈痛a平臺,正是實現(xiàn)這一目標的有效途徑。以下是一些關鍵步驟,幫助您快速實現(xiàn)這一目標:常見用戶關注的問題:
一、如何快速把系統(tǒng)變?yōu)榈痛a平臺,助企業(yè)轉型提速?
1. 選擇合適的低代碼平臺
首先,您需要選擇一個適合您企業(yè)需求的低代碼平臺。市場上有許多優(yōu)秀的低代碼平臺,如OutSystems、Mendix、PowerApps等。選擇時,要考慮平臺的易用性、功能豐富性、社區(qū)支持等因素。
2. 培訓和團隊建設
低代碼平臺雖然降低了開發(fā)門檻,但仍然需要一定的技術背景。因此,對團隊成員進行培訓,提高其對低代碼平臺的熟悉度,是至關重要的。同時,組建一支跨部門、多技能的團隊,有助于更好地應對項目挑戰(zhàn)。
3. 制定清晰的轉型計劃
在轉型過程中,制定一個清晰的計劃至關重要。這包括確定轉型目標、時間表、資源分配等。同時,要確保計劃具有可執(zhí)行性,并能夠根據(jù)實際情況進行調整。
4. 逐步實施
轉型不是一蹴而就的,需要逐步實施。可以從簡單的項目開始,逐步擴大規(guī)模。在實施過程中,要關注項目的進度和質量,確保項目按計劃推進。
二、低代碼平臺如何幫助企業(yè)降低開發(fā)成本?
低代碼平臺通過簡化開發(fā)流程,降低了對專業(yè)開發(fā)人員的需求,從而有效降低了企業(yè)的開發(fā)成本。以下是低代碼平臺降低開發(fā)成本的幾個方面:
1. 簡化開發(fā)流程
低代碼平臺提供了可視化的開發(fā)環(huán)境,用戶可以通過拖拽組件、配置參數(shù)等方式快速構建應用。這大大縮短了開發(fā)周期,降低了人力成本。
2. 減少對專業(yè)開發(fā)人員的需求
低代碼平臺降低了開發(fā)門檻,使得非技術人員也能參與到應用開發(fā)中。這意味著企業(yè)可以減少對專業(yè)開發(fā)人員的需求,從而降低人力成本。
3. 提高開發(fā)效率
低代碼平臺提供了豐富的組件和模板,用戶可以快速搭建應用。這提高了開發(fā)效率,縮短了項目周期,降低了開發(fā)成本。
4. 降低維護成本
低代碼平臺的應用易于維護和升級。當企業(yè)業(yè)務發(fā)生變化時,只需對應用進行簡單的調整即可。這降低了維護成本,提高了企業(yè)的競爭力。
三、低代碼平臺如何幫助企業(yè)提高開發(fā)速度?
低代碼平臺通過簡化開發(fā)流程、提供豐富的組件和模板,有效提高了企業(yè)的開發(fā)速度。以下是低代碼平臺提高開發(fā)速度的幾個方面:
1. 簡化開發(fā)流程
低代碼平臺提供了可視化的開發(fā)環(huán)境,用戶可以通過拖拽組件、配置參數(shù)等方式快速構建應用。這大大縮短了開發(fā)周期,提高了開發(fā)速度。
2. 豐富的組件和模板
低代碼平臺提供了豐富的組件和模板,用戶可以快速搭建應用。這些組件和模板經過優(yōu)化,能夠滿足各種業(yè)務需求,從而提高開發(fā)速度。
3. 跨平臺支持
低代碼平臺支持多種平臺,如Web、移動、桌面等。這使得企業(yè)可以快速開發(fā)跨平臺應用,滿足不同用戶的需求。
4. 易于集成
低代碼平臺支持與其他系統(tǒng)集成,如ERP、CRM等。這使得企業(yè)可以快速實現(xiàn)業(yè)務流程的整合,提高開發(fā)速度。
四、低代碼平臺如何幫助企業(yè)提升用戶體驗?
低代碼平臺通過簡化開發(fā)流程、提供豐富的組件和模板,有效提升了用戶體驗。以下是低代碼平臺提升用戶體驗的幾個方面:
1. 簡化操作流程

低代碼平臺提供了直觀的操作界面,用戶可以輕松上手。這降低了用戶的學習成本,提升了用戶體驗。
2. 個性化定制
低代碼平臺支持用戶根據(jù)自身需求進行個性化定制。這使得用戶可以更好地適應自己的工作習慣,提高工作效率。
3. 快速響應
低代碼平臺的應用易于維護和升級。當用戶反饋問題時,企業(yè)

















